Becoming
a Shared Housing home
provider offers many
benefits: a bit of extra
income from rent, help
with chores, companionship
or preventing loneliness,
practice in seeing what
it’s
like to share your home.
All
prospective tenants
are prescreened, and
background checks are
conducted. All efforts
are made to find a compatible
match for you. No one
is placed with you until
you have met and fully
approved the individual.
